Born in Beersheba on 15 Nov. 1943; fled with his family to Gaza during the Nakba, and from there to Cairo during the 1956 Suez crisis; studied Medicine and Politics in Frankfurt/Main, Germany, from 1963-73; Fateh member since the mid-1960s; in 1967 he moves to Algeria, where he receives partisan training; soon after he is arrested in Hebron; upon his release returned to Germany; co-founder of the General Union of Palestinian Students and Workers in Europe; President of the Confederation of Palestinian Students in the Federal Republic of Germany and Austria from 1968-73; following the 1972 Munich attack he was - together with some 300 other Palestinians - expelled from Germany; elected PNC member since 1972; returned to Germany and worked at the Arab League office in Bonn in the mid-1970s; also helped establishing a Palestine Information Office in Bonn which functioned as unofficial PLO representation; was elected member of the Fateh Revolutionary Council since 1978; became in 1982 head of the PLO delegation to Austria and permanent PLO representative to UNIDO in Vienna (until 1985); elected to the Fateh Central Committee in 1989, with the assignment to advise Pres. Yasser Arafat on European affairs; since 1993 head of the General PLO Delegation to Germany; since 1998, member of the PLO Central Council; Fateh leader in Gaza; has authored The PLO and Palestine – Past and Presence (Frankfurt, 1982).
